结构体赋值:将学生学号设置为16

在C语言中,结构体可以用来组织相关数据。例如,我们可以定义一个名为'student'的结构体,包含学生的学号、性别、姓名和成绩。

struct student {
  int num;
  char sex;
  char name[20];
  float score;
} st;

为了将学生学号赋值为16,我们可以使用以下语句:

st.num = 16;

在这个语句中,'st'是结构体变量,'num'是结构体中的成员变量,'16'是我们要赋的值。

解释:

  1. st 是一个名为 student 的结构体类型的变量。
  2. numstudent 结构体中的一个成员变量,它是一个整型变量,用来存储学生的学号。
  3. st.num = 16; 使用点运算符将值 16 赋值给结构体变量 st 中的成员变量 num

总结:

通过结构体和点运算符,我们可以轻松地访问和修改结构体成员变量的值,并有效地管理相关数据。


原文地址: https://www.cveoy.top/t/topic/ouIu 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录